In summary

Sage Lakes Municipal Golf Club in Idaho Falls is praised for its well-maintained course, friendly staff, and family-friendly atmosphere. The course layout is described as flat and straightforward, with notable water features adding to the challenge. While many appreciate the ease of walking and the quality of the greens, some visitors have mentioned issues with booking tee times and occasional slow pace of play.

12 years ago
Course was in superb shape when I played (Aug 2013). Greens were fast and smooth, challenging without being tricked-out. Course overall is flat with modest sized trees. Water comes into play on about half the holes. An excellent venue for walking. At 4500+ feet altitude, course plays shorter than what might expect (usually 1-2 club difference). No GPS or beverage cart service, but staff was friendly and helpful. Relatively easy access off of I-15 or Hwy 20. Pleased to recommend.
